The Time For Prayer

Recently a group of friends and I arrived at a restaurant for dinner and for some reason the hostess could not find our reservation on their schedule. Since there were about a dozen of us we had to wait a bit for them to be able to get tables to seat us together. But they managed it and as we were about to begin our meal they asked me if I would ask the blessing.

As I opened my mouth to begin the first thing that popped out wasn't the traditional grace we say over a meal. What was in my heart was what spilled out..."Father...thank You for seats at Your table tonight...". Gratitude for our time together, for food to eat and God's blessing over our food and our lives was included and it was a sweet moment that we all felt.

Often we may think that prayer needs a specific format, a determined time of day or a designated location, as in morning devotion prayer, a blessing over our food prayer or a bedtime prayer. However, Ephesians 6:18 instructs us to "Pray in the Spirit at all times and on every occasion. Stay alert and be persistent in your prayers for all believers everywhere."

Our closest communion with God will be honest, vulnerable conversations that can happen any time of the day or night. Yes He is Almighty God, Creator of Heaven and Earth and all that is in it. He is also the lover of your soul and He delights in drawing near to us every time we are mindful to draw near to Him. Tell Him what's on your heart. He can work with that!
